chipped the rav last week, wasnt a particularly easy job as the cr sensor was in the worst place possible on the common rail. and the gap we needed to get into was only just big enough to squeeze ya hand in let alone fiddle around trying to disconnect the connection (the clip is underneath the damn thing)

anyway, an hour later its all sorted and boy what a difference both in performance and fuel economy. it drives like a petrol engine and the torque is wickedly powerful, and we managed 200 miles on just under half a tank of diesel, we reckoned on saving about tenner on what we would usually spend............next trip, in June, is to london, followed by a trip to bromsgrove so will be interesting to see how well it goes then :)

definately well worth the £99 me OH spent :)

"Made In Germany With OEM Plugs - Not A Cheap Replica!" It says.

Well the car connecting ends would have to be I suppose, but the connector to the box looks like one of those highly reliable :rolleyes: and widely used under bonnet by VMs (not!) 9 pin D connectors - i.e. like a PC serial port. :rolleyes:. I could be mistaken of course.

Surely they could have found a more suitable automotive connector.

Would be interesting to know, exactly where and to what this box is connecting.

This unit has just 2 leads you unplug the oem connector on the common rail, plug 1lead into that,then the other lead from the chip connects to the lead you have just disconnected..on 4.3 you could fit in literally 5mins..on 4.2 because of position of connector it is virtualy impossible to get to and i take my hat off to whoever fitted (Jans)? :unsure:

fitting instructions spot on LH and ya can take your hat off to me and me oh then cos we fitted it ourselves.....it was a mare of a job and took an hour, but so far defo worth it. My oh has been modifying cars for years (rightly assisted by me). He knows a good deal when he sees one and he isn't a newbie to Toyota's (previously owning a twin turbo supra), but he has said that this was one of the hardest things to fit due to where the connector is located........you defo need 2 pairs of hands, something vaguely resembling a hook ;) and a screwdriver..........what makes the job even harder still is that the connector clip is located UNDER the connector so ya cant even poke summat down thro the small gap and push the clip in (if ya see what i mean) to slide the connector off............that was the bit that took the most time and 2 people to crack :)
